Ukraine, step by step, is bringing Russia back to the fact that the war must end, the president said.
The Russian invaders were suffering losses at the front and losing military potential. This is definitely the main goal for the Armed Forces of Ukraine, President Vladimir Zelensky wrote in Telegram on Wednesday, December 11.
The head of state said that today he heard a report from the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, Alexander Syrsky. He thanked the soldiers who dealt a significant blow to Russian targets last night.
“Military facilities on the territory of Russia were hit, as well as facilities in the fuel and energy complex, which are working for aggression against our state and people. The Commander-in-Chief reported the details of the defeat .It is precisely this kind of scope and precision that gradually brings Russia back to reality – to the fact that “the war must end,” Zelensky said.
Syrsky also reported on all major front-line directions. Now the hottest is in the Donetsk region, especially the Pokrovskoe and Kurakhovskoe directions. The situation in the Kursk operational areas was assessed.
“Heavy fighting continues. The Russian army, as in November, now, in December, is losing people in battles and attacks at a record level. These months – November and December – record losses in Russia. I thank all our soldiers for their steadfastness … We reduce the Russian military potential is our main goal now,” the president noted.
Let’s recall that in November the average daily losses of the Russian army reached a new historical maximum – 1,523 deaths per day.
